On a chilly night at the Wild Colonial in Providence, I need something on draft to perk me up. Meet Brewshire Brewing Company’s Coffeehaus Porter. This little number has strong roasted coffee and dark chocolate hints, and the bitter mouth of the beer goes a long way to complement it. There’s not even a hint of sweetness and the alcohol is fleeting. It’s like drinking your coffee black.

Grade: A-
